So I've had mercalli 5 about two weeks now, and I put TI jazz flats on it, and managed to put together a jam sesh with some people who all tested negative for the Rona. The mercalli was perfect in every way. I barely had to adjust my amp settings, just turned my gain down a bit since these pickups are hot. It sat right where I wanted in the mix, and I was able to get a lot of different tones out of it for different types of jams. It responded really great to pedals. And the cherry on top is that it's super light and comfortable to play for extended periods of time. I don't feel like I'm feeling the weight of the bass, my hands can just do the work. I'm so glad I ended up buying this instead of a fender P5 or Yamaha bb.
